Milton "Mike" Kelley died in Cypress, Texas, on November 25, 2019, at the age of 66.
Mike was born on January 21, 1953, in Houston, Texas, to Wesley Kelley and Doris O'Brien. He graduated from Spring Branch High School 1973. He married Karen Kleb in 1975. After moving to Cypress, they started their family and had two daughters. Mike enjoyed his career as an Engineer. He retired from Baker Hughes in Tomball in 2015. He loved listening to and playing classic rock, singing in the Houston Lutheran Chorale, camping, hunting, and fishing.
He was preceded in death by his father, Wesley Kelley.
Survivors include his wife, Karen; daughters, Amber (Eric) Keown and Shawna (Jason) Honeycutt; grandchildren, Nathan, Avery, and Lillian Keown, and Colin, Kendall, Olivia, and Ian Honeycutt; his mother and stepfather, Doris and Joseph O'Brien; his sister, Peggy (Ken) Bible; and a nephew, Christopher Bible.
A memorial service is scheduled for 11:00 a.m. on Saturday November 30, 2019, at Salem Lutheran Church, 22601 Lutheran Church Road, Tomball, TX 77377. All are welcome to attend and celebrate Mike's life. In lieu of flowers, donations can be made to the music ministry at Salem Lutheran Church.
